ISOC Q2 Community Forum. 15 April 2015 - The agenda has a special focus on Latin America and the Caribbean and was opened by Raúl Echeberría, our Vice President for Global Engagement. Olaf Kolkman, our Chief Internet Technology Officer, followed up with a look at the top issues related to Internet Technology - such as our approach to Internet security. We also made sure that we covered the latest developments on Internet Governance and feature some very interesting data from the recently completed ISOC survey on the topic. Finally, there is an update on our upcoming global virtual event: InterCommunity 2015.
